"Idol" Reject Josiah Leming Goes Ahead With Album, Despite Lawsuit Threats
Despite being threatened with a lawsuit by "American Idol" last month, former "Idol" hopeful Josiah Leming still plans to release his debut album in January. Not only is the 19-year-old continuing to work with Warner Music Group's Reprise Records, he tells MTV News a preview EP of his "Angels Undercover" single is now streaming on his MySpace page. Leming raised eyebrows back in October when he announced his plan for an album with Warner Records. According to policy on the hit Fox show, all "American Idol" contestants must sign a contract stating they can only sign on with the show's chosen label, Sony-BMG. Leming was known on "Idol's" seventh season as the contestant who lived in his car and was working to raise money for his cancer-stricken mother. He was eliminated before making the final 24.
